Commission meeting, Galt, Ont., Oct. 6, 1958.

File consists of minutes, supporting documents and related correspondence, some original, for a special meeting held to "inform the Commission concerning the results of the Special Committee's meeting with the Minister, Department of Planning and Development, subsequent correspondence and a personal meeting the Chairman had with the Minister regarding the use of lands owned by the Commission in the Conestogo Area."

Includes correspondence between Chairman M. Pequegnat and W.M. Nickle, Minister of the Dept. of Planning and Development, concerning the Commission's legal authority to lease cottage lots. At this meeting Ilmar Kao was appointed as Manager and Assistant Secretary as of Oct. 15, 1958. Includes ms. notes.

P.M. Rogers : weekly reports.

Material relating to activities of P.M. Rogers, Forester, GRCC, including reforestation projects, Lake Belwood woodlands policies and reports, Conestogo land clearing project, employees hired, etc. Includes correspondence, Luther Lake reforestation and woodlot map, newspaper clippings, reports. Includes newspaper article "Men restore Shand forests after 150 years of abuse," Kitchener-Waterloo Record, Thursday June 28, 1956, Section 2, p. 25. Also includes J. Lynton Martin article concerning GRCC reforestation: "Trees and water go together," Forest and Outdoors (April 1957): 16. Includes handwritten notes.
